**Administrator - 37.5 hours per week**
**Reporting into the Home Manager, responsibilities will include**:
- Implementing and maintaining effective administration and financial systems to meet location, customer and any external requirements.
- To be accountable for providing accurate information as required and ensuring admin processes and documentation are in place.
- Managing transactions in line with financial procedures and ensure reporting systems are maintained in the absence of the manager.
- Complying with CQC essential standards and Anchor procedures.
**Required knowledge & experience**:
- Level 2 Business Administration or Customer service level 2.
- Previous experience of working in an office environment.
- Understanding of financial procedures, debt management, income collection and payroll processes, along with budget management.
- Managing customers’ personal monies and an understanding of confidentiality and data protection within a care setting.
- Health & safety in the workplace.
**Required skills**:
- Computer literate with experience of a variety of IT packages.
- Well organized with good planning skills.
- Able to produce and present numerical data accurately with attention to detail. Able to work individually and as part of a team.
